baller
adjective
- very "cool" or stylish.
Just got my new Jordan's. They're baller.

noun
- a person who balls.
He's a baller.
Last edited on Mar 19 2014. Submitted by Jose M. from Tuscaloosa, AL, USA on Jun 29 1998.
- someone who is really good at a ball game, especially basketball.
I'm the best baller this town has ever seen.
Jimmy is a baller.
Man, that dude is a baller. He just scored 40 points in a single game.
Man, Jimmy is a top baller. He's got 3 sacks on us today.

- complementary paintball colloquialism referring to an excellent player, especially in speedball or X-ball.
Damn right Ricky's a baller. He bunkered both of those fools rolling out of the dorito to grab that flag!

ballistic
adjective
- extremely angry.

balloon
noun
- a twenty dollar bill.
Can I borrow a balloon from you til payday. I'm twenty dollars short on rent.Last edited on Oct 04 2012. Submitted by Anonymous on Oct 04 2012.
notes
- Used mostly between wiseguys and drug dealers.
